Site Description
The Youth Services Center (YSC) is the District of Columbia’s detention center for male and female youth, responsible for the care and custody of young people placed in secure detention by court order from the DC Superior Court Family Court Division.
Position Overview
The CTE Technology Instructor provides instruction in foundational and emerging technology skills to youth residing in a juvenile detention center. This role focuses on equipping students with practical, workforce-aligned competencies, including digital literacy, digital citizenship, keyboarding, basic computer operations, and introductory concepts in artificial intelligence (AI). The instructor designs and delivers instruction that leads to industry-recognized microcredentials, preparing students for successful reentry into school, training programs, or employment.The role requires flexibility and adaptability in planning and delivering instructional strategies to meet scholars' needs.
